Man City vs Brighton Betting Trends & Stats
- Manchester City sits in first place on the 2021-22 Premier League Table with a 23-5-3 record (74 points) and a plus-52 goal differential.
- Brighton & Hove Albion sits in 11th place on the 2021-22 Premier League Table with an 8-13-10 record (37 points) and a minus-9 goal differential.
- Manchester City is 3-2-0 (W-D-L) in its last five matches.
- Brighton & Hove Albion is 1-1-3 (W-D-L) in its last five matches.
- Manchester City is 4-0-1 (W-D-L) in its last five matches against Brighton & Hove Albion.
